129  Other / Archival / Re: Pictures of your mining rigs! on: January 08, 2014, 09:14:01 PM

Don't MSI 7950's and Sapphires exhaust out the back (through the bracket vents)?  If so, aren't the box fans on the wrong side of the the rigs?  Essentially it looks like you're blowing back into the exhausts.

Unless those box fans are facing the other way and you're actually pulling the hot air away... hard to tell.

This is the most common question I get asked...  

Yes, I am blowing air into the same end that have the display ports.  This is because the fans are axial.  They simply suck air in from the side and then blow it directly over the heatsinks.  The air is then exhausted pretty much at random from that point although more comes out the end opposite the display ports than does the end with the display ports.  I tried flipping the cards around and blowing air into the end opposite the display ports and the temps were 10+ degrees higher versus the way I have it setup now.

133  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Pools (Altcoins) / Re: [ANN] profit switching auto-exchanging pool - middlecoin.com on: January 08, 2014, 07:19:07 PM
For the guys that are running 100+ mh/s farms: are you running on 120 or 220 volt systems? I'm debating making the switch to 220 to lower the Amperage on each system and gain some efficiency.  What kind of amp load are you seeing for a 4 GPU (290 or 280X) system?

Anyone running a significant amount of hashpower is not using 120V.  My farm is approx 18Mh/s and I'm using 240V.  I have three phase power to my facility (600A total) though my PDUs are currently single phase only.

A 4-card 280X rig will pull around 1100W.
